Tour Overview
This 12-day Tanzania cultural photography safari is designed for photographers who want to capture the essence of local life, traditions, and breathtaking landscapes. From the open plains of West Kilimanjaro to the remote villages of Monduli Juu, Engaruka, and Lake Natron, each day brings opportunities to document unique cultures, traditional practices, and stunning scenery.
Day-by-Day Itinerary
Day 1: Arrival in Arusha
Your journey starts in Arusha, the gateway to Tanzania’s safari destinations. Upon arrival, a private driver will take you to a luxury lodge, where you can relax after your travels. Enjoy fine dining and unwind by the pool or spa, preparing for the adventure ahead.
Day 2-3: West Kilimanjaro - Maasai Community
Head to the West Kilimanjaro region, home to vast landscapes and Maasai villages. Photograph traditional Maasai homesteads, daily activities, and the golden-hour views of Mount Kilimanjaro. Engage with locals as they tend to livestock and create intricate beadwork. Capture the contrast of ancient traditions against the modern world.
Day 4-5: Monduli Juu - The Highlands and Traditional Healing Practices
Travel to Monduli Juu, a highland village surrounded by rolling hills. Spend time with Maasai elders, documenting their herbal medicine practices and storytelling sessions. The landscapes offer dramatic backdrops for portrait photography, with soft morning light highlighting the natural beauty of the region.
Day 6-7: Engaruka - Ancient Ruins and Agricultural Traditions
Visit the historic Engaruka ruins, an abandoned farming settlement with a fascinating irrigation system. Capture the daily life of the local community, from farming techniques to pottery-making. The evening light transforms the rugged landscape into a striking scene for landscape photography.
Day 8-10: Lake Natron Village - Flamingos and Traditional Livelihoods
Lake Natron, famous for its flamingo population and alkaline waters, provides incredible opportunities for wildlife and landscape photography. Spend time with the local Maasai community, documenting their way of life, cattle herding, and traditional dance ceremonies. The reflections of the surrounding mountains in the lake’s surface create stunning compositions.
Day 11: Return to Arusha
Drive back to Arusha, stopping at scenic points for any final photography opportunities. The evening is free for rest or exploring the local markets.
Day 12: Departure
Depending on your flight schedule, enjoy a relaxed morning before heading to the airport. Take home a collection of powerful images that tell the story of Tanzania’s diverse cultures and landscapes.
